Closing the door
1. Clean the door gaskets.
2. If necessary, adjust the door. Refer to "Installation".
3. If necessary, replace the defective door gaskets.
Contact the Authorised Service Centre.

Location
Refer to the assembly instructions for the
installation.
To ensure best performance, install the appliance well
away from sources of heat such as radiators, boilers,
direct sunlight etc. Make sure that air can circulate
freely around the back of the cabinet.
Positioning
This appliance can be installed in a dry, well ventilated
indoor where the ambient temperature corresponds to
the climate class indicated on the rating plate of the
appliance:
Climate
class
Ambient temperature
SN +10°C to + 32°C
N +16°C to + 32°C
ST +16°C to + 38°C
T +16°C to + 43°C
Some functional problems might occur
for some types of models when
operating outside of that range. The
correct operation can only be guaranteed
within the specified temperature range. If
you have any doubts regarding where to
install the appliance, please turn to the
vendor, to our customer service or to the
nearest Authorised Service Centre.
